Synopsis

Elements of Universal History: For Higher Institutes in Republics, and for Self-Instruction offers a clear, didactic tour through world history, designed for serious study in republics and for self-education. The volume emphasizes how political events shape civilization and how history can guide moral insight.

This edition presents history in a structured way, dividing material into distinct periods and focusing on the rise and spread of ideas, governments, and cultures. It combines narrative with guided exercises that help readers grasp dates, figures, and connections, while encouraging active engagement with the material.


  • Accessible narrative that foregrounds political history, civilization, and key authors across eras.

  • Sequential periods that trace ancient to modern developments, including revolutions, reforms, and discoveries.

  • End-of-section exercises to reinforce understanding and chronology.

  • Contextual notes on major civilizations, religious shifts, and the evolution of laws and learning.



Ideal for students and adult learners seeking a thorough, workshop-friendly overview of universal history in a republic-minded framework.
